Over time, this has repeatedly been recognized as a possible concern for social media apps, as they look at the incentives that drive destructive behaviors and experiences.

Former Twitter chief Jack Dorsey, for instance, famous again in 2018 that by emphasizing follower counts, that then drives people to publish extra polarizing content material, as that then boosts their publicity potential, and helps them achieve extra followers. And the apps themselves are inadvertently incentivizing this.

As per Dorsey:

“[We initially] made the [followers] font dimension a bit of bit larger than all the things else on the web page. We didn’t actually suppose a lot about it, and we moved on to the following downside to unravel. What that has carried out is we put all of the emphasis, not meaning to, on that variety of how many individuals comply with me. So if that quantity is massive and daring, what do individuals wish to do with it? They wish to make it go up.”

Twitter sought to handle this by… making the follower depend font barely smaller.

Which, as you may in all probability guess, was not an excessively efficient method.

Instagram, too, has made strikes to redirect person incentives, by hiding like counts on posts, as a way to “depressurize Instagram for younger individuals”, in line with Mosseri himself.

So Mosseri, and Meta, are well-versed within the potential harms and destructive behaviors that focus metrics can drive.
